Analysis
The most recent figure for population, age 22, male in Lithuania is 23,735, measured in 2015.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 4.7% on the previous year and down 8.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, population, age 22, male in Lithuania peaked at 28,513 in 1990 and was at its lowest, 23,609, in 2000.
That places Lithuania 138th out of 191 countries with data for 2015, putting it in the middle of the range.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 26,878 | 23,995 | 28,513 | 10 |
| 2000s | 25,641 | 23,609 | 28,085 | 10 |
| 2010s | 26,230 | 23,735 | 28,072 | 6 |
